Commercial Slab Construction in Franklin, TN

Commercial slab construction services involve creating solid concrete foundations for a variety of business and industrial projects. These services typically cover the preparation and pouring of concrete slabs for warehouses, retail spaces, manufacturing facilities, parking lots, and other large-scale structures. Property owners interested in this service should understand the importance of proper site assessment, soil preparation, and reinforcement to ensure durability and stability of the foundation. Clarifying project scope, size, and specific load requirements can help determine the best approach for a successful build.

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to know about the materials used, the construction process, and any necessary permits or approvals. It’s also helpful to consider the intended use of the space, as different projects may require specific design features or load capacities. Clear communication about project details and expectations can support a smooth construction process, resulting in a foundation that meets the needs of the property and its future use.

Project Types

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s

Commercial slab foundations - essential for supporting large commercial buildings and warehouses.

Parking lot slabs - durable surfaces designed for vehicle traffic and heavy loads.

Sidewalk and walkway slabs - smooth, level surfaces for safe pedestrian access around properties.

Loading dock slabs - reinforced concrete areas built to withstand frequent heavy use.

Patio and outdoor space slabs - functional surfaces for outdoor seating and recreational areas.

Industrial floor slabs - specialized concrete floors designed for manufacturing and storage facilities.

FAQ

Commercial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king areas, and loading docks on business properties.

How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ab depends on its intended use, often ranging from 4 to 8 inches for durability and support.

What materials are used in commercial slab construction? Concrete is the primary material,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h for added strength.

Why is proper soil preparation important for a commercial slab? Proper soil preparation ensures stability and prevents cracking or shifting of the slab over time.
